Output d4152a1abafdf83768337962aa0d94f659630c7abde9419a08b0970ad3025584:1

value
433216260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28e1b514f4560ef5657d17cdbed644a8bd1d7baf OP_EQUALVERIFY OP_CHECKSIG
address
D8sFxMSsRZBf2iUjzFKxWpCmua2p2BC21n
transaction
d4152a1abafdf83768337962aa0d94f659630c7abde9419a08b0970ad3025584